Manu Bennett
Born on October 10, 1969, in Rotorua, New Zealand, he is an actor renowned for his dynamic roles in film and television. He gained international fame portraying the fierce gladiator Crixus in the TV series "Spartacus." He also played the menacing orc chief Azog in "The Hobbit" film series. Educated in Australia, he has a background in dance and drama. His diverse heritage, including Māori, Irish, and Scottish roots, has influenced his versatile acting career.
